About 2 Southdown Cottages
2 Southdown Cottages is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Higher Clovelly, Bideford, Bideford (EX39 5SA). It has a recorded floor area of 165 m² (around 1776 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(February 2017) shows an E (score 42),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to A (score 97), a 4-band jump. Main heating runs on lpg. Other recorded features include notable views, a self-contained annexe and outbuildings. Period features are noted in the property record.
At 165 m² the property is well over the postcode median (77 m² across 8 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 4 planning records sit against the property, 4 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, partial demolition and a conservatory,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2002–2020,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£535,000 is 28.9% above the 2020 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£234/sq ft) was about 16%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: October 2020 at £415,000.
